Inter Milan will miss out on signing Lille defender Tiago Djalo, who is set to undergo medicals on a move to Juventus next week.

This according to Sky Sport Italia transfer market expert Gianluca Di Marzio, via FCInterNews.

For the past several weeks, Inter have been working to secure an agreement with Djalo on a summer free transfer.

The Nerazzurri have been keen on the 23-year-old as a target for a while.

And the fact that Djalo’s contract with Lille expires at the end of June has marked him out as a free transfer opportunity for the summer.

Inter’s penchant for hunting free transfer signings is no great secret.

So the Nerazzurri have been in active contact with Djalo’s representatives for months. And the player has given his assent to the move.

But Juventus have come onto the scene. And the Bianconeri look to have just about won the battle for Djalo’s signature.

A key factor has been Lille’s desire not to lose Djalo on a free transfer.

The Ligue 1 side have been aiming to cash in on the young defender while they have the chance this month.

That is in contrast to Inter’s strategy. The Nerazzurri have only been planning to sign Djalo on a free transfer in six months’ time, when his contract with Lille runs out.

Therefore, the French side have made clear to top clubs around Europe that they will accept a relatively low offer for Djalo this month.

And the Bianconeri have taken the opportunity to swoop.

Juventus made an offer worth around €3.5 million plus add-ons. Lille have accepted this bid.

The Bianconeri have still had to convince the player.

But according to Di Marzio, Djalo has decided to accept a move to Juventus.

Now, the move is all set to happen. Only the last formalities are necessary.

Di Marzio reports that Djalo will fly to Italy for medicals on a move to Juventus next week.
